Soundtrack for the theatre piece »Stromberger oder Bilder von Allem« played at Vorarlberger Landestheater, Bregenz, between March 3 and April 7 2024.

///

Around 80 years after the end of the Second World War, the era of contemporary witnesses is coming to an end. How can we counteract forgetting today, at a time when right-wing nationalist thinking is regaining strength? What role models can we find in the rubble of history to encourage us today? Which stories continue to have an impact today?

At the center of Gerhild Steinbuch's commissioned play for the Vorarlberger Landestheater is the biography of Maria Stromberger. The Catholic nurse volunteered to go to Auschwitz in 1942. She wanted to see »what it was really like« and became an active supporter of the resistance movement in the concentration camp. After the war, she lived in seclusion in Bregenz. As she was accused of being involved in the mass killings in Auschwitz, she was temporarily imprisoned together with local "greats" of the Nazi state. Former prisoners from Auschwitz campaigned for her release and rehabilitation. Only in recent years, however, has Maria Stromberger's life story been thoroughly reappraised and honored.

Four protagonists embark on a search in the play. They are children of the 1990s, the »decade of freedom« and right-wing extremist attacks in Austria and Germany. They search for an appropriate way of remembering the Holocaust and the difficult and contradictory ways in which it has been dealt with in post-war Austria up to the present day. Where are the limits of remembrance, of »how it really was«, of what is worth remembering? How can we dare, despite all the difficulties? How can we live with a past that is not dead, not even past?
